Pashinyan is preparing for a peace agreement with Baku

Nicole Pashinyan's team is currently preparing an agreement on friendship and cooperation with Azerbaijan. This means a peace agreement.

Axar.az reports that the statement came from former Armenian Ambassador to the Vatican Mikayil Minasyan.

According to him, in order to complete this agreement, Pashinyan needs a parliament under his control, which Pashinyan wants to achieve through the June elections:

"In this case, he has the support of all foreign players - Turkey, Russia, Azerbaijan, the silent United States, France and Britain. Even the Soros Globalist Project supports this process.”
